Cherrybrook Care Home is a large, purpose designed service in Bradford, providing specialist care across two units for 120 residents with complex mental health needs, dementia and challenging behaviours. The home delivers high quality, clinically led care within a structured and supportive environment, combining specialist nursing expertise with a strong focus on dignity, stability and person centred support.
As a Senior Care Assistant, you will support the delivery of high quality, person centred care for individuals with complex needs, including advanced dementia, mental health conditions and other long term health challenges. You will take responsibility for the smooth running of your shift, ensuring care is well organised, consistent and delivered safely within a structured and supportive environment. Alongside providing hands on care, you will oversee medication, monitor residents’ physical and emotional wellbeing and respond appropriately to changes, including behaviours or complex needs. Working closely with the wider team, you will support and guide Care Assistants, helping to maintain a calm, stable and consistent environment. You will follow and review care plans, ensure accurate record keeping and contribute to effective communication with colleagues, families and healthcare professionals. This role requires a confident, calm and resilient approach, with the ability to support both residents and staff in a complex care setting.
What We Are Looking For:
- NVQ Level 2 in Health & Social Care (minimum), with Level 3 desirable or willingness to work towards
- Medication administration training with competency
- Experience supporting or leading a care team within a care environment
- Confidence supporting individuals with complex needs, including mental health or behavioural support
- Strong communication and teamwork skills
- A calm, patient and professional approach
